Peter Scott explores Kabardino-Balkaria, a mountainous republic of striking landscapes and ancient traditions. Here, local culture is preserved through dance, costume and craftsmanship.

Ethnographer Galimat Makoeva explains the traditional Kafa dance. It was once performed exclusively by princes. The music is lively, yet the dancers move with restraint and grace. Partners barely touch — such is the custom.

Clapping was once believed to protect against the 'evil eye', while a dancer’s costume revealed much about its wearer. For instance, the colour of a woman’s dress indicated her age and social status.

Peter also visits the home of craftswoman Asiyat, where he learns how a burka is made — a heavy felt cloak for horsemen that provides shelter and protection from the cold on long journeys. In Khamzat’s forge, Peter discovers how a dagger is crafted from layered steel — a symbol of honour and freedom in the Caucasus.
